Closet Enlargement in Denver County, CO
Closet enlargement services involve expanding existing closet spaces to better accommodate storage needs within a home. These projects typically include removing or modifying walls, adding new shelving or hanging areas, and optimizing the layout to maximize available space. Homeowners often seek this service when their current closets feel too small for their belongings or when upgrading a bedroom or dressing area to improve organization and accessibility.
Before requesting closet enlargement, property owners should consider the current layout and structural elements of their home, as well as any specific storage requirements. It’s helpful to have a clear idea of the desired closet size and features, such as additional shelving, drawers, or custom compartments. Understanding the scope of the project and any potential structural adjustments can facilitate a smoother planning process and ensure the expanded closet meets individual storage preferences.

Closet Enlargement Questions
What is closet enlargement? Closet enlargement involves expanding existing closet space to increase storage capacity and improve organization within a home or property.
What types of closet expansion projects are common? Typical projects include adding shelving, installing custom organizers, or extending closet dimensions through wall modifications.
Are there design options for closet enlargement? Yes, options range from maximizing vertical space to incorporating built-in drawers and specialized storage solutions tailored to needs.
What should property owners consider before starting? It’s important to evaluate current space, desired storage needs, and any structural aspects that may impact the enlargement process.
